What the work involvesSin cartel en el arranque, cada persona decide sola por dónde entrar, y eso abre sendas nuevas y roza lo que hay que cuidar. Un panel simple con el mapa y las reglas del lugar ordena la visita desde el primer paso. Lugar: sendero de las dunas y playa pública de Monte Hermoso. EN: With no panel at the entrance, every visitor decides alone where to go in, and that opens new paths and rubs against what needs protecting. A simple board with the map and the site rules orders the visit from the first step. Site: the public dune trail and beach at Monte Hermoso.
How this work is done
A documented method, so this packet comes out the same whoever does it.
Steps
- 1. Confirmar ubicación, contenido y diseño con el organismo a cargo, y fotografiar el arranque sin cartel. EN: Confirm location, content and design with the managing office, and photograph the trailhead with no panel.
- 2. Marcar y abrir a mano las bases de los postes a la profundidad indicada por el diseño. EN: Mark and hand-dig the post footings to the depth the design calls for.
- 3. Plomar y fijar los postes, montar el bastidor y colocar el panel provisto, con la cubierta con caída. EN: Plumb and set the posts, fit the frame, and mount the supplied panel with a sloped cover.
- 4. Verificar firmeza, fotografiar el cartel terminado desde el mismo punto y registrar dimensiones y materiales. EN: Check it is firm, photograph the finished kiosk from the matching vantage, and record dimensions and materials.
What counts as done
- Foto del arranque sin cartel. EN: Before photo of the trailhead with no panel
- Profundidad de base y dimensiones del bastidor registradas. EN: Footing depth and frame dimensions recorded
- Confirmación de postes a plomo, firmes al empujar. EN: Confirmation posts are plumb and firm when pushed
- Foto del cartel terminado desde el mismo punto. EN: After photo of the finished kiosk, matching vantage
Proof is measured against these, not judged by taste.
